Rwanda High Commission to Celebrate Kwibohora 31 – Rwanda’s 31st Liberation Day in Islamabad
Islamabad – 30th June, 2025 (Adnan Hameed) : The High Commission of Republic of Rwanda in Islamic Republic of Pakistan is set to host Kwibohora 31 – Rwanda’s 31st Liberation Day on Friday, July 4, 2025, at Sheesh Mahal, Serena Hotel, Islamabad.
The event will commemorate the nation’s liberation journey and progress since the 1994 Genocide against the Tutsi.
Ms. Harerimana Fatou, High Commissioner of Republic of Rwanda to Islamic Republic of Pakistan, will welcome an audience of distinguished guests including senior government officials, diplomats, business leaders, members of the media and the friends of Rwanda.
“Kwibohora 31” reflects Rwanda’s journey from 4th July 1994 since today as a country with commitment to inclusive growth, peace, sustainable development and international cooperation. The event will feature traditional Rwandan cultural performances, a short film on Rwanda’s transformation over the past three decades and its growing role in global peacekeeping, economic development and diplomacy, but also reaffirm the deepening ties between Rwanda and Pakistan in areas such as trade, investment, defense, health, education, and diplomacy.
